We are seeking a Staff Accountant who will be responsible for performing a variety of accounting tasks,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and timeliness in financial transaction processing, reporting, reconciling, and auditing.
* This role requires you to report to our office in La Mesa, California, every day.
* This role requires strong computer skills, including proficiency with Microsoft Office (Excel) and accounting software.
* 2+ years of experience in finance or accounting.

Essential Functions:
- Ensure compliance with accounting standards and internal controls.
- Collaborate with team members to improve accounting processes and systems.
- Perform bank and account reconciliations to identify and resolve discrepancies.
- Create invoices (via import and manual) for all incoming contracts received.
- Payment application to invoices.
- Audits DMS sales and invoice transactions.
- Deposits check payments to the bank.
- Support the month-end and year-end close processes.
- Adds Customers and Item Codes into the accounting system as needed.
- Runs Monthly Statements once contracts are balanced.
- Prints all Monthly Statements, sorts, and reviews.
- Monitor and analyze data to identify trends and variances.
- Email out monthly statements to Agents.
- Mails out monthly statements to Dealers.
- Assists with Data Entry with reports when time allows/as needed.
- Strives to enforce and live Portfolio’s Philosophy each and every day.
- Takes ownership of changes and is personally responsible for managing change in an upbeat, positive manner.
- Support budgeting, forecasting, and financial planning activities.
- Ad hoc analysis projects.
- Other job duties as assigned.
